- Key Factors to Consider Before Buying Before clicking"Add to Basket,"buyers ought to evaluate numerous crucial components toguarantee the selected treadmill matches their specific requirements: Available
space saving treadmill: Measure the space two times-- both when the treadmill remains in usage and when it is folded. Do not forget to inspect ceiling clearance, particularly if the treadmill has a steep incline and the user is tall. Motor Power(HP/CHP): Continuous Horsepower(
- CHP)measures the motor's
- capability to preserve sustained power. Walkers
- : 1.5 to 2.0 CHP is enough. Joggers/Runners: Look for a minimum of 2.5 to 3.0
- CHP for smooth operation without lagging. Running Deck Size: Taller users with longer strides need a belt that is at least 140 cm long and 48 cm broad to run comfortably without fear of stepping off the edge. Cushioning: Road running places high effect forces on joints. Try to find adjustable or multi-point cushioning systems
- if joint security is a top priority. Often Asked Questions( FAQs)Q: Do I require a floor mat under my treadmill? A: Yes, a high-density rubber devices mat is highly suggested. It safeguards carpets and hardwood floorings from sweat andvibration, decreases operational sound for downstairs neighbours, and avoids dust from going into the motor. Q: How much maintenance does a home treadmill need? A: Most contemporary treadmills requirereally little maintenance. The most crucial job is oiling the running belt with silicone-based lubricant
- every few months(depending upon use)to minimize friction and extend the lifespan of the motor and deck. Q: Can I utilize a treadmill without a subscription? A: Absolutely. While brand names like NordicTrackgreatly promote their iFit subscriptions, the basic manual modes on these treadmills electric operate completely fine without paying a month-to-month charge. Users can still adjust speed and slope by hand orenjoy their own gadgets on the integrated tablet holders. Q: Are folding treadmills stable?
A: High-quality folding treadmills sale, such as the JTX Sprint 5 or Reebok Jet 300, utilize durable hydraulic locking mechanisms that make them simply as steady during workouts as non-folding commercial designs. Nevertheless, ultra-slim walking pads might have more flex
